The story of Margaret Wentworth Waldegrave began in 1453 in Codham, Yorks, England. Margaret Wentworth Waldegrave married Sir William Walgrave. Margaret Wentworth Waldegrave passed away in 1540 in Bures St Mary, Babergh District, Suffolk, England.
